Output 68f6469eb4b8a3d2b493f81a2043fb34b732768dc835edb5a491b9639cf7d0df:40

value
211861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0387e6d50027bf017f0bdd0be998491839388d67 OP_EQUAL
address
321gkjXa2kh1m4XbhV3vayQJjYxe86H5wr
transaction
68f6469eb4b8a3d2b493f81a2043fb34b732768dc835edb5a491b9639cf7d0df
confirmations
328
spent
true